Output 10b6af30eefdb22073602614d09fa8551f70f02b48ec4e1d80d0f8533a25fc18:4

value
569301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f347bfeac31517e849158d95c78f9d330d4e4092 OP_EQUAL
address
3PsN5Qw2FAr45SsoF9oeoriksYyKrHuh7s
transaction
10b6af30eefdb22073602614d09fa8551f70f02b48ec4e1d80d0f8533a25fc18
spent
true